Technical Project Manager facilitates overall project delivery from receipt of order/assignment through project acceptance. Maintains clear communication with all stakeholders – including customers, end users, and interdisciplinary teams alike. Directs project status updates, accounting directives, and workflow for assigned team-members. Responds to matters of urgency with a level of prioritization and ability to operate under pressure. Escalates issues appropriately to functional managers, directors, and upper management, as needed, where it impacts projects overall delivery and profitability.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Consistently utilizes established project management tools to drive productivity, accountability, and buy-in from all stakeholders (Rolling Action Items List, Schedule, etc.)
- Develops and maintains healthy and productive relationships with interdisciplinary teams between both AWR, ESD, customers, and end users.
- Drives assigned personnel to on-time and on-budget projects by developing team goals and removing roadblocks.
- Responds to project-needs with clear communication – timely, accurate, direct, and or empathetic.
- Monitors procurement processes and coordinates with relevant personnel to achieve expected project schedule and project budget.
- Works effortlessly in systems like Oracle Netsuite, Smartsheet, Microsoft Project, and Microsoft 365.
- Utilizes established project management tools to drive productivity and accountability (Rolling Action Items List, Schedule, etc.)
- Creates and gains acceptance on project documentation to better monitor project status and deliverables (Engineering Change Orders, Factory Acceptance, etc.).
- Navigates complex situations and with buy-in, determines a concise plan or path to resolution/execution.
- Carries oneself as a professional and maintains respect amongst peers and customers.
- Based on business-need, assist, support, or perform other duties within defined scope and ability – assuming accountability and responsibility for those assigned projects or programs.
- Adheres to Gosiger’s Vision, Mission, and Values as outlined in the Employee Handbook.
- Adheres to established project management processes/workflows and role-specific swim lanes (where relevant) to guide project execution.
- Continuously reviews current processes and searches out improvement methods to improve product/process quality, reduces waste, rework, and unnecessary work that adds no value to the work or processes.
Qualifications
- Exceptional communication with strong emotional intelligence and sound decision-making in customer-facing situations.
- Project Management in a complex cross-functional environment. Machine Tools or Metal Manufacturing background preferred.
- Mechanical/Technical competency required. Strong interest in machines or how-things-work preferred.
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
- Demonstrated problem solving skills.
- Independent technology user with platforms such as Microsoft 365, Microsoft Project, Smartsheet, and Oracle Netsuite.
